How to Fix Weird errors when booting into Big Sur installation
This mini-guide provides a structural approach to troubleshoot and fix the issue.
Prerequisites
- Confirm your hardware specifications (CPU, GPU, Motherboard).
- Ensure you have a bootable recovery USB and backup your EFI.
Fix Steps
- Check if your GPU requires WhateverGreen or specific boot-args (e.g., agdpmod=pikera).
- Ensure Metal acceleration is fully supported for your macOS version.
- Update Lilu and WhateverGreen to the latest versions.
Verification
- Reboot and verify if the functionality is restored and stable under typical usage.
